Understanding the Natural History Early in the Course or Presentation of Friedreich Ataxia
Withdrawn before enrolling
Conditions studied: Friedreich Ataxia, Rare Diseases
In brief
Multicenter, prospective, observational natural history and outcome measure study of children and young adults with Friedreich ataxia.
